Soho in the Fifties Summary

Soho in the Fifties by Daniel Farson

This is a celebration of London's most fascinating quarter, attempting to capture the intrigue, enticement and atmosphere of the Bohemian world, illustrated with photographs. The author decribes the principal venues of the time such as the York Minster, Wheeler's, the Caves de France and the Colony and draws profiles of the true Soho personalities he knew, among them David Archer, John Deakin, Francis Bacon, Muriel Belcher, Nina Hamnett and Colin MacInnes. Dan Farson has also written The Man Who Wrote Dracula, Henry Williamson: A Personal Memoir, Out of Step, A Window by the Sea and Jack the Ripper.
